如何在iOS上配置V2Ray WS和TLS

在当今的互联网环境中,保护个人隐私和安全显得尤为重要。V2Ray作为一种高效的网络代理工具,因其灵活性和强大的功能受到广泛使用。本文将详细介绍如何在iOS设备上配置V2Ray WS(WebSocket)和TLS(传输层安全性)。

什么是V2Ray?

V2Ray是一个用于实现网络代理的工具,其核心是通过多种传输协议来保护用户的网络安全。相较于传统的代理工具,V2Ray具备以下特点:

  • 多种传输协议:支持VMess、Shadowsocks、HTTP/2等多种协议。
  • 灵活性:用户可以根据需求进行高度自定义配置。
  • 高隐匿性:能够有效绕过网络封锁,保持在线隐私。

WebSocket和TLS的概念

什么是WebSocket?

WebSocket是一种网络通信协议,主要用于在客户端和服务器之间进行实时双向数据传输。它适用于需要高频率数据交换的场景,例如即时通讯和在线游戏。

什么是TLS?

TLS(传输层安全性)是一种加密协议,用于保护互联网上的数据传输。它通过加密机制保证数据在传输过程中的安全性,避免中间人攻击等安全隐患。

iOS上安装V2Ray的准备工作

在开始配置之前,请确保您已经具备以下条件:

  • 一台iOS设备(iPhone或iPad)
  • App Store中下载V2Ray兼容的客户端(如Shadowrocket或Kitsunebi)
  • 一个有效的V2Ray服务器

在iOS上配置V2Ray WS和TLS的步骤

步骤一:安装V2Ray客户端

  1. 打开App Store,搜索并下载一个V2Ray客户端(推荐使用Shadowrocket或Kitsunebi)。
  2. 安装完成后,打开应用程序。

步骤二:配置V2Ray服务器信息

  1. 在V2Ray客户端中,找到“配置”或“服务器”选项。
  2. 点击添加服务器,输入服务器的相关信息:
    • 地址:服务器IP或域名
    • 端口:服务器的监听端口(通常是443或80)
    • 用户ID:VMess ID(通常为UUID格式)
    • 传输协议:选择“WebSocket”
    • TLS加密:勾选TLS选项以启用加密传输。

步骤三:配置WebSocket选项

  1. 在“WebSocket”设置中,填写以下内容:
    • 路径:服务器上配置的WebSocket路径,通常为/ray或其他自定义路径。
    • Host:如有必要,填写主机域名(例如,用于伪装的域名)。

步骤四:保存并连接

  1. 完成配置后,保存设置。
  2. 在客户端中选择刚才添加的服务器,点击连接。成功连接后,您应该能正常访问被墙网站。

常见问题解答

Q1:V2Ray的WebSocket和TLS有什么优势?

  • 提高隐蔽性:使用WebSocket和TLS可以伪装成普通HTTPS流量,难以被检测和屏蔽。
  • 更安全的传输:TLS协议可以加密传输内容,保护用户数据不被窃取。

Q2:如果V2Ray连接不成功,我该如何排查问题?

  • 确认输入的服务器地址、端口和用户ID是否正确。
  • 检查网络连接,确保iOS设备已连接互联网。
  • 尝试更换网络环境,如使用Wi-Fi或移动数据。
  • 查阅V2Ray客户端的日志,寻找错误信息进行修复。

Q3:在iOS上使用V2Ray需要注意哪些事项?

  • 确保定期更新V2Ray客户端,以获取最新的功能和安全补丁。
  • 使用有效且稳定的V2Ray服务器,以确保连接的流畅性。
  • 不要分享您的用户ID和服务器信息,以保护账户安全。

Q4:如何保持V2Ray的稳定连接?

  • 在V2Ray服务器上配置合理的带宽和连接数限制。
  • 使用优质的网络服务提供商,确保网络稳定。
  • 定期检查V2Ray客户端的配置和状态。

结论

通过以上步骤,您已成功在iOS设备上配置了V2Ray的WebSocket和TLS。此配置能够帮助您在互联网中更安全地浏览和访问各种资源。希望本文对您有所帮助,如果有任何问题,欢迎随时咨询。

正文完